The incredible true story of the doctor who traced London's cholera
outbreak to a single water pump, and went on to save countless lives
through his groundbreaking research! Dr. John Snow is one of the most
influential doctors and researchers in Western medicine, but before he
rose to fame, he was just a simple community doctor who wanted to
solve a mystery. In 19th century London, the spread of cholera was as
unstoppable as it was deadly. Dr. Snow was determined to stop it, but
he had a problem: His best theory of how the disease was spread flew
in the face of popular opinion. He needed evidence, and he needed to
find it fast, before more lives were lost. Taking on the role of
detective as well as doctor, Dr. Snow knocked on doors, asked
questions and mapped out the data he'd collected. What he discovered
would come to define the way we think about public health to this day.
This compelling nonfiction picture book is a timely reminder of the
power of science to save lives.
